Understanding Excel Sheets and Workbooks

Before we delve into organization techniques, let's clarify some terms. In Excel, a workbook is the file you create and save, which can contain multiple sheets or worksheets. Each sheet is like a separate page within the workbook, allowing you to keep different types of data or analyses separate from one another.

Understanding this structure is key to effective organization. By keeping related data on the same sheet and separating unrelated data onto different sheets, you can maintain a clear and logical layout.

Naming Conventions

One of the simplest yet most powerful ways to organize your sheets is by using clear and consistent naming conventions. This helps you and others (if you're collaborating) quickly understand the purpose of each sheet and find the information you need.

For example, you might use a format like "Department_Project_Task" for your sheet names. This makes it easy to see that the sheet "HR_Recruitment_Vacancies" is related to the HR department's recruitment process. You can also use color-coding or icons in your sheet tabs to further distinguish between different types of sheets.

Master Detail Relationship

One way to structure your sheets is by using a master-detail relationship. The master sheet contains a summary of your data, while the detail sheets contain the full data set. This allows you to see an overview of your data at a glance, while still having access to the full details when you need them.
